Enterprise Application Developer
General Summary
The Enterprise Application Developer will develop, implement, and support business solutions across the full software development life cycle (SDLC). This role will support the Director of IT Applications in the execution of all principal functions of the IT Applications group and will serve as a point of contact between the IT Applications group and functional users. This position is specifically responsible for the analysis, design, development, testing, integration, deployment, and ongoing maintenance of complex solutions supporting the College's Enterprise Resource Planning software (Ellucian Banner) and related Ellucian applications, including Degree Works and Self-Service Banner.
Essential Job Functions
- Ability to investigate application shortcomings and research new products to provide recommendations for system and process improvements.
- Quickly convert ideas to solutions consistent with the SDLC development methodology for new projects and customizations.
- Diagnose and resolve software issues reported to our Service Desk staff and ticket management system.
- Provide application and user support to the core Ellucian Banner suite including Banner Admin Pages, Job Submission, Degree Works, Self-Service Banner, and customizations.
- Help support our integration initiatives with 3rd party products, using APIs, Ellucian Ethos, ILP 5, Go Anywhere and other integration tools.
- Ensure all developed solutions adhere to institutional data security policies, FERPA regulations, and applicable federal and state compliance requirements.
- Participate in peer code reviews to ensure code quality, consistency with development standards, and alignment with security and architectural best practices.
- Create and maintain comprehensive technical documentation for all developed integrations, APIs, and customizations, including data flow diagrams, endpoint specifications, authentication methods, and error-handling procedures, to support ongoing maintenance and institutional knowledge retention.
Unlock this job opportunity
View more options below
View full job details
See the complete job description, requirements, and application process



